    Modern crime fiction has extended well beyond victim, crime, and detective mysteries, including genres such as espionage thrillers such as Ian Fleming's "James Bond" series and criminal-life dramas like Mario Puzo's "The Godfather."
    www.languagehumanities.org/what-is-crime-fiction.…
    Early examples of crime stories include Thomas Skinner Sturr's anonymous Richmond, or stories in the life of a Bow Street officer (1827), Steen Steensen Blicher 's The Rector of Veilbye (1829), Philip Meadows Taylor 's Confessions of a Thug (1839), and Maurits Christopher Hansen's " Mordet paa Maskinbygger Roolfsen" - The Murder of Engineer Roolfsen (1839).

    What does crime fiction mean?Crime fiction, detective story, murder mystery, mystery novel, and police novel are terms used to describe narratives that centre on criminal acts and especially on the investigation, either by an amateur or a professional detective, of a crime, often a murder.
    What is a good example of crime writing?In Arabian Nights, for example, Scheherazade tells the story of a murder investigation to stave off her own murder. Looking further east, a popular and dynamic form of crime writing known as gong’an, or court-case fiction, had already emerged in China in the 10th century.
